'Cool Hand Luke' copycat gets 14 years in prison for cutting heads off parking meters
Paul Newman was sentenced to two years in prison in Florida in the 1967 movie "Cool Hand Luke" for cutting the tops off parking meters.
Anthony Downs didn't get so lucky.
Downs was sentenced on Tuesday to 14 years in prison for taking the heads off 79 parking meters in downtown Fort Worth while he was on parole last spring.
Newman played Luke Jackson in the movie and he sawed the tops off parking meters after a night of drinking, then he refused to conform to prison life.
Police believe Downs was taking the meter heads for the coins.
For several weeks in early 2017, police discovered an estimated 79 heads of parking meters and sometimes their poles stolen from various locations downtown.
A special police detail ended the crime spree in March.
Officers saw Downs just north of the 1000 block of Burnett Street, staying in the shadows and running back and forth across the street.
Detectives and officers heard "banging noises," which police say was consistent with the way Downs was using metal water-meter covers to bang underneath meter heads to loosen them or cut them off.
Downs ran, but he was captured after a brief foot pursuit.
The Fort Worth man had previously been arrested for burglary of a building, stealing from a coin-operated machine and drug possession, police said.
